Many people wonder whether therapy delivered online can make a meaningful difference. For common concerns such as stress, anxiety, depression, relationship challenges, or navigating life changes, research shows that online therapy can be just as effective as traditional in-person sessions.
One major benefit is flexibility – clients can choose the format that fits their needs and schedules, whether that is video calls, phone sessions, live chat, or in-app messaging. This range of options makes it easier to maintain continuity of care and to fit therapy into a busy life.
All therapists offering online services are licensed professionals, and individuals have the option to change therapists if they decide a different fit would be more helpful. Online therapy can be a practical, effective way to access professional support for many common mental health and life concerns.
